Roger P. Smith is a scholar working on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Roger P. Smith has authored 69 papers receiving a total of 1.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Surgery, 19 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 11 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Roger P. Smith's work include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(9 papers), Methemoglobinemia and Tumor Lysis Syndrome (6 papers) and Menstrual Health and Disorders (6 papers). Roger P. Smith is often cited by papers focused on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(9 papers), Methemoglobinemia and Tumor Lysis Syndrome (6 papers) and Menstrual Health and Disorders (6 papers). Roger P. Smith coll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and United Kingdom. Roger P. Smith's co-authors include Harriet Kruszyna, Lori G. Rochelle, Robert Kruszyna, Thomas E. Nolan, Gary M. Joffe, Kirk P. Conrad, M. D. Mosher, Norman Wolmark, Edward H. Romond and Jennifer Bryant and has published in prestigious journals such as JNCI Journal of the National Cancer Institute, Analytical Biochemistry and The FASEB Journal.
